Fukura Station (吹浦駅, Fukura-eki) is a railway station in the town of Yuza, Yamagata, Japan, operated by East Japan Railway Company (JR East).

Lines[edit]

Fukura Station is served by the Uetsu Main Line, and is located 186.1 km from the starting point of the line at Niitsu Station.

Station layout[edit]

The station has one side platform and one island platform connected by a footbridge. The station is unattended.

History[edit]

Fukura Station opened on July 30, 1920.[1] The station has been unattended since October 1981.[citation needed] With the privatization of JNR on April 1, 1987, the station came under the control of JR East.
